GridForge is Lexicon Labs' internal crossword generator: it assembles grids from the WordWell corpus, scores fill quality, and exports puzzles to the Quillpress pipeline. When reviewing changes, please run the full constraint-solver test suite locally, since CI skips the slow symmetry checks. The solver service requires authenticated access to the clue-ranking endpoint, and review builds will fail without it. Before opening your first review environment, configure the credential below, which grants read-only staging access.

API key for yahig-tadup: kto7_ubizbYm

# Retention Sweeper — Limits & Quotas

The Palegrove sweeper deletes expired records nightly across all shards. Hard limits exist to protect the primary: it will not exceed the per-shard delete rate, and it aborts if replication lag crosses the threshold. Do not bump these during an incident without paging storage on-call. If the sweep falls behind, extend the window rather than raising rates. Current enforced values follow.

constants for yawig-fahif:
RATE_LIMITS = {
    "wenath": 5,
    "oliwyn": 10,
    "ralael": 5,
    "druix": 10,
}

Attendees: leadership team plus sales leads. Quick recap: we agreed in principle to the franchise deal with Orvanto Trading for the Sellwick territory. Royalty rate settled at the mid-range figure from last month's talks, with a three-year exclusivity window. Marketing support costs are shared, training is on us. Legal drafts the agreement next week; sales leads should hold off on territory commitments until it's signed. Questions went to the usual channel. The confidential note on our wider plans sits below.

board note of baweg-bawig: Project Tamath slips by six weeks because of the audit delay.

Step 4 of deploying Sketchloom: the undo/redo history service needs its own env file, since diagram edit stacks persist server-side. Copy `env.sample`, set `HISTORY_DEPTH=200`, and don't touch the replay flags yet. Then add the history store credential on the very next line.

sealed setting: ARCHIVE_KEY3=8d0